Warning: Can't synchronize with repository "(default)" (/home/git/ome.git does not appear to be a Git repository.). Look in the Trac log for more information.
Notice: In order to edit this ticket you need to be either: a Product Owner, The owner or the reporter of the ticket, or, in case of a Task not yet assigned, a team_member"

Task #12226 (closed)

Opened 10 years ago

Closed 10 years ago

BUG:Move tag set to other group (QA 9197)

Reported by: omero-qa Owned by: dlindner
Priority: minor Milestone: Unscheduled
Component: from QA Version: 5.0.1
Keywords: n.a. Cc: ux@…, otto.manneberg@…
Resources: n.a. Referenced By: n.a.
References: n.a. Remaining Time: n.a.
Sprint: n.a.

Description

https://www.openmicroscopy.org/qa2/qa2/qa/feedback/9197/

Comment: Attempted to move a tag set from one group to another using the menu found by right-clicking the tag set under "Tags". Am owner of both groups.

java.lang.Exception: Abnormal termination due to an uncaught exception.

java.lang.IllegalArgumentException: Unsupported type: class pojos.TagAnnotationData

	at org.openmicroscopy.shoola.env.data.views.calls.DMLoader.<init>(DMLoader.java:154)

	at org.openmicroscopy.shoola.env.data.views.DataManagerViewImpl.loadContainerHierarchy(DataManagerViewImpl.java:92)

	at org.openmicroscopy.shoola.agents.treeviewer.MoveDataLoader.load(MoveDataLoader.java:87)

	at org.openmicroscopy.shoola.agents.treeviewer.view.TreeViewerModel.fireMoveDataLoading(TreeViewerModel.java:1473)

	at org.openmicroscopy.shoola.agents.treeviewer.view.TreeViewerComponent.moveObject(TreeViewerComponent.java:230)

	at org.openmicroscopy.shoola.agents.treeviewer.view.TreeViewerComponent.handleSplitImage(TreeViewerComponent.java:4767)

	at org.openmicroscopy.shoola.agents.treeviewer.ImageChecker.handleResult(ImageChecker.java:118)

	at org.openmicroscopy.shoola.env.data.events.DSCallAdapter.eventFired(DSCallAdapter.java:90)

	at org.openmicroscopy.shoola.env.data.views.BatchCallMonitor$1.run(BatchCallMonitor.java:124)

	at java.awt.event.InvocationEvent.dispatch(Unknown Source)

	at java.awt.EventQueue.dispatchEventImpl(Unknown Source)

	at java.awt.EventQueue.access$200(Unknown Source)

	at java.awt.EventQueue$3.run(Unknown Source)

	at java.awt.EventQueue$3.run(Unknown Source)

	at java.security.AccessController.doPrivileged(Native Method)

	at java.security.ProtectionDomain$1.doIntersectionPrivilege(Unknown Source)

	at java.awt.EventQueue.dispatchEvent(Unknown Source)

	at java.awt.EventDispatchThread.pumpOneEventForFilters(Unknown Source)

	at java.awt.EventDispatchThread.pumpEventsForFilter(Unknown Source)

	at java.awt.EventDispatchThread.pumpEventsForHierarchy(Unknown Source)

	at java.awt.EventDispatchThread.pumpEvents(Unknown Source)

	at java.awt.EventDispatchThread.pumpEvents(Unknown Source)

	at java.awt.EventDispatchThread.run(Unknown Source)

Abnormal termination due to an uncaught exception.

java.lang.IllegalArgumentException: Unsupported type: class pojos.TagAnnotationData

	at org.openmicroscopy.shoola.env.data.views.calls.DMLoader.<init>(DMLoader.java:154)

	at org.openmicroscopy.shoola.env.data.views.DataManagerViewImpl.loadContainerHierarchy(DataManagerViewImpl.java:92)

	at org.openmicroscopy.shoola.agents.treeviewer.MoveDataLoader.load(MoveDataLoader.java:87)

	at org.openmicroscopy.shoola.agents.treeviewer.view.TreeViewerModel.fireMoveDataLoading(TreeViewerModel.java:1473)

	at org.openmicroscopy.shoola.agents.treeviewer.view.TreeViewerComponent.moveObject(TreeViewerComponent.java:230)

	at org.openmicroscopy.shoola.agents.treeviewer.view.TreeViewerComponent.handleSplitImage(TreeViewerComponent.java:4767)

	at org.openmicroscopy.shoola.agents.treeviewer.ImageChecker.handleResult(ImageChecker.java:118)

	at org.openmicroscopy.shoola.env.data.events.DSCallAdapter.eventFired(DSCallAdapter.java:90)

	at org.openmicroscopy.shoola.env.data.views.BatchCallMonitor$1.run(BatchCallMonitor.java:124)

	at java.awt.event.InvocationEvent.dispatch(Unknown Source)

	at java.awt.EventQueue.dispatchEventImpl(Unknown Source)

	at java.awt.EventQueue.access$200(Unknown Source)

	at java.awt.EventQueue$3.run(Unknown Source)

	at java.awt.EventQueue$3.run(Unknown Source)

	at java.security.AccessController.doPrivileged(Native Method)

	at java.security.ProtectionDomain$1.doIntersectionPrivilege(Unknown Source)

	at java.awt.EventQueue.dispatchEvent(Unknown Source)

	at java.awt.EventDispatchThread.pumpOneEventForFilters(Unknown Source)

	at java.awt.EventDispatchThread.pumpEventsForFilter(Unknown Source)

	at java.awt.EventDispatchThread.pumpEventsForHierarchy(Unknown Source)

	at java.awt.EventDispatchThread.pumpEvents(Unknown Source)

	at java.awt.EventDispatchThread.pumpEvents(Unknown Source)

	at java.awt.EventDispatchThread.run(Unknown Source)

Exception in thread "AWT-EventQueue-0"



	at org.openmicroscopy.shoola.env.ui.UserNotifierImpl.showErrorDialog(UserNotifierImpl.java:191)

	at org.openmicroscopy.shoola.env.ui.UserNotifierImpl.notifyError(UserNotifierImpl.java:291)

	at org.openmicroscopy.shoola.env.AbnormalExitHandler.doTermination(AbnormalExitHandler.java:147)

	at org.openmicroscopy.shoola.env.AbnormalExitHandler.terminate(AbnormalExitHandler.java:85)

	at org.openmicroscopy.shoola.env.RootThreadGroup.uncaughtException(RootThreadGroup.java:69)

	at java.awt.EventDispatchThread.processException(Unknown Source)

	at java.awt.EventDispatchThread.pumpOneEventForFilters(Unknown Source)

	at java.awt.EventDispatchThread.pumpEventsForFilter(Unknown Source)

	at java.awt.EventDispatchThread.pumpEventsForHierarchy(Unknown Source)

	at java.awt.EventDispatchThread.pumpEvents(Unknown Source)

	at java.awt.EventDispatchThread.pumpEvents(Unknown Source)

	at java.awt.EventDispatchThread.run(Unknown Source)

Change History (5)

comment:1 Changed 10 years ago by dlindner

Reason is, moving tags to other group is not implemented. Intentionally? Disable menu entry for tags or implement functionality?

comment:2 Changed 10 years ago by dlindner

  • Cc ux@… added

comment:3 Changed 10 years ago by dlindner

Going to disable the menu entry for the moment; needs mockup what to do when tags are moved (whether moving all the tagged objects, too; etc.).

comment:4 Changed 10 years ago by jburel

Maybe close and create new tickets/cards when done with mock-up

comment:5 Changed 10 years ago by dlindner

  • Resolution set to fixed
  • Status changed from new to closed

Fixed by: https://github.com/openmicroscopy/openmicroscopy/pull/2382
Moving tags/tagsets to other group disabled for the moment.

Note: See TracTickets for help on using tickets. You may also have a look at Agilo extensions to the ticket.

1.3.13-PRO © 2008-2011 Agilo Software all rights reserved (this page was served in: 0.70090 sec.)

We're Hiring!